First off, I think this was a novella because at novel length they would have had to do a lot of explaining, and would have failed at it. At novella length, they can handwave and just push on with, "I know, but listen, this is such a great idea so never mind that and I'ma tell you what happens."

They nearly lost me at the key plot point when
Spoilershe blows up the AI, disabling the ship, then rebuilds an entire starship AI from spare parts using the manual and some hand tools.


Or in explaining how
Spoilerthe bad guys who don't exist yet are able to prepare the world they're going to exist in.
.

Still an intriguing idea, and told smoothly enough that we have to find out what happens.

I thought this was an excellent novella, once started, I couldnt put it down. The story could have been developed into a full length book and had more depth, but as it was, it was fast paced and engaging. I loved the sci-fi themes in it and the subtle love story that projected it forward. Again, would have liked to have read it as a full length book but I was really pleased with it. Definitely worth the time as it's only 170 pages.
